Objective of the research is to develop annular-type drilling tools, which application increases mechanical velocity of drilling and overall productivity of drilling operations. Methodology is represented by the following: analysis and generalization of the scientific and technical achievements in mining industry; mathematical and physical modeling; and numerical methods of solution. Findings – a drill bit with following features has been developed: first, during the initial well sinking, the bit operates with one group of cutters; after their blunting, the worn hard-alloy cutting structure is replaced with the new sharp one, and well sinking continues without the tool lifting from the well. A multilayered drill bit has been developed with the equally loaded impregnated diamond-containing layers of comb profile, which using increases the bit durability and drilling productivity. Area of rational application of hard-alloy and diamond drill bits for core sampling during the exploratory drilling has been specified by means of comparative analysis of 1 m well cost drilled under the same mining and geological conditions using the mentioned tool. Originality – the operation of a drill bit with a telescopic cutting structure and a diamond bit with the equally loaded profile of diamond-containing comb-shape layers has been substantiated. It has been determined that the most prospective tendency meant for increasing durability of hard-alloy tools is in the development of a combined bit, which allows replacing the cutting structure, worn while drilling, with the new one without the drill string lifting onto the surface. Practical implications – drill tools (a bit with the telescopic cutting structure and diamond multilayered impregnated bit with the equally loaded profile of diamond-containing layers) are patented at the Patent Office of Kazakhstan. Use of the mentioned drill tools both increases productivity and reduces costs of drilling operations. Increase in the diamond tool durability is also provided by the creation of multilayered drill bits, which matrix height includes several impregnated diamond-containing layers of comb profile, divided by the diamondless layers of less hardness.
